You will be responsible as the Environmental Education Officer managing the delivery of education projects and programs within Council and for our community to support the achievement of targets within Our Green City Plan 2028.

To be successful in this role you will have tertiary qualifications in Environmental Education, Environmental Science or a related discipline, or equivalent work experience and proven experience in researching, developing and delivering sustainability and waste educational programs.
